On flat grassland with good views in all directions, no surface remains visible of any enclosure in area marked on six inch OS 6-inch map. Depicted as semi-circular-shaped enclosure (diam. c. 17m) on 1st (1840) ed. OS 6-inch map. It is depicted in more detail on the 25-inch OS map as a circular raised area surrounded by a fosse (diam. 12m). This depiction suggests the monument is a barrow, possibly a ring-barrow, but as an outer bank is not depicted it is classified as a possible ditch barrow.
